Who We Are
At Framework, we believe the time has come for products that are designed to last. Founded in San Francisco in 2020, our mission is to remake Consumer Electronics to respect people and the planet.
We've started with two award-winning products, the Framework Laptop 13 and 16. Our laptops are thin, light, high-performance notebooks that can be upgraded, customized, and repaired in ways that no other notebook can. Alongside this, we've launched the Framework Marketplace to enable an ecosystem of parts and modules.
In 2025, we added two new products to our lineup: The Framework Laptop 12, a 2-in-1 convertible with a 12.2" touchscreen and stylus support, and our first non-laptop product, the highly customizable and powerful Framework Desktop, a compact system for gamers and ML enthusiasts.
We've seen a fantastic reception to both of our laptops from customers and reviewers from outlets like Linus Tech Tips, Ars Technica, and multiple Wirecutter reviews (including a recommendation among the best Windows Ultrabooks of 2024), along with making TIME's Best Inventions lists in 2021 and 2023. As a company, we were #35 on Fast Company's Most Innovative Companies of 2022.
We come from successful consumer electronics startups including the founding team of Oculus, and have closed multiple rounds of funding to fuel our roadmap. Even better (and maybe unusually for an early stage startup), we're in a financially healthy position going forward off of our product revenue.
